Output e34ba14f92ab88f74ee1172e3dcbcbc3799588a827e783c068c6070192327031:0

value
38751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ff2ca44494a5ac6955c6cbb9851f7a46fda9cbb6 OP_EQUAL
address
3QxFiDcME2PXtrKj8Ayfi7z6Gh8DaYAy8D
transaction
e34ba14f92ab88f74ee1172e3dcbcbc3799588a827e783c068c6070192327031
spent
true